Indio CA Real Estate Market: Home Prices

Recent market data shows that home prices in Indio are still holding fairly steady.

Redfin reports a median sale price of about $550,000https://www.redfin.com/city/9273/CA/Indio/housing-market?utm_source=chatgpt.com

Homes.com reports a similar number, with a median sale price of about $545,000 over the past 12 months. https://www.homes.com/indio-ca/?utm_source=chatgpt.com

These numbers can change from month to month, but they give us a good picture of the overall market.

Homes Are Taking Longer to Sell

Homes are not selling as quickly as they did during the hottest parts of the market.

Redfin shows a median of about 91 days on market.

Homes.com reports an average of about 60 days on market.

The numbers are different because each site measures the market in a different way. However, both show the same trend.

Buyers have more time.

This means sellers need to make a strong first impression. A home that is priced well and shows well can still stand out.

Is Indio a Buyer’s or Seller’s Market?

Right now, buyers have more negotiating power than they did a few years ago.

Redfin describes Indio as a somewhat competitive market. Homes are often selling slightly below asking price.

That does not mean sellers cannot get a good price.

It does mean that buyers are paying closer attention to value.

Some buyers may be able to negotiate on price, repairs, closing costs, or other terms.

Not All Indio Neighborhoods Are the Same

This is one of the most important things to understand about real estate in Indio.

The city has many different types of homes and neighborhoods.

You’ll find:

  • Gated communities
  • Golf course homes
  • 55+ communities
  • Newer construction
  • Established neighborhoods
  • Homes with pools
  • Homes with larger lots

Because of that, one citywide number cannot tell you exactly what a home is worth.

Location, condition, upgrades, lot size, and features all matter.

A pool, casita, RV access, or golf course view can also affect value.

What Buyers Should Know

If you are thinking about buying in Indio, this market may give you more breathing room.

You may have more time to compare homes and ask questions before making an offer.

You may also have more room to negotiate.

Still, well-priced homes can move quickly.

It is always a good idea to have your financing ready before you start shopping seriously.

What Sellers Should Know

For sellers, pricing is one of the biggest factors right now.

Buyers can easily compare your home with other listings and recent sales.

If a home is priced too high, it may sit on the market longer.

That can lead to price reductions later.

A strong strategy is to price the home based on recent comparable sales and current competition.

Good photos, clean presentation, and strong marketing also matter.
